a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orFilippos Karapetis2014-12-03 00:53:36 +0200
committerFilippos Karapetis2014-12-03 00:53:36 +0200
commit61f654e4eee90d761c06583a67dc9631db9d0d29 (patch)
treeaaedd1e8739dbb4b89fb19028f9535514deb3e94
parent11d41ace02ce84ab40de2ae315a106950579e2bd (diff)
downloadscummvm-rg350-61f654e4eee90d761c06583a67dc9631db9d0d29.tar.gz
scummvm-rg350-61f654e4eee90d761c06583a67dc9631db9d0d29.tar.bz2
scummvm-rg350-61f654e4eee90d761c06583a67dc9631db9d0d29.zip
ZVISION: Explicitly define which version of atan2() to use
This is needed by MSVC
-rw-r--r--engines/zvision/graphics/render_table.cpp2
-rw-r--r--engines/zvision/scripting/controls/safe_control.cpp2
2 files changed, 2 insertions, 2 deletions
diff --git a/engines/zvision/graphics/render_table.cpp b/engines/zvision/graphics/render_table.cpp
index 629cbde3cf..5500b50ba8 100644
--- a/engines/zvision/graphics/render_table.cpp
+++ b/engines/zvision/graphics/render_table.cpp
@@ -200,7 +200,7 @@ void RenderTable::generateTiltLookupTable() {
float fovInRadians = (_tiltOptions.fieldOfView * M_PI / 180.0f);
float cylinderRadius = halfWidth / tan(fovInRadians);
- _tiltOptions.gap = cylinderRadius * atan2(halfHeight / cylinderRadius, 1.0) * _tiltOptions.linearScale;
+ _tiltOptions.gap = cylinderRadius * atan2((float)(halfHeight / cylinderRadius), 1.0f) * _tiltOptions.linearScale;
for (uint y = 0; y < _numRows; ++y) {
diff --git a/engines/zvision/scripting/controls/safe_control.cpp b/engines/zvision/scripting/controls/safe_control.cpp
index de1ece5b19..66ab53085f 100644
--- a/engines/zvision/scripting/controls/safe_control.cpp
+++ b/engines/zvision/scripting/controls/safe_control.cpp
@@ -181,7 +181,7 @@ bool SafeControl::onMouseUp(const Common::Point &screenSpacePos, const Common::P
Common::Point tmp = backgroundImageSpacePos - _center;
- float dd = atan2(tmp.x, tmp.y) * 57.29578;
+ float dd = atan2((float)tmp.x, (float)tmp.y) * 57.29578;
int16 dp_state = 360 / _statesCount;